- PRODUCTION METHOD OF CAPSINOID BY DEHYDRATING CONDENSATION, STABILIZING METHOD OF CAPSINOID, AND CAPSINOID COMPOSITION
-
In the production methods of capsinoid by esterification using an enzyme, a method of conveniently obtaining capsinoid in a high yield in a short time without using a dehydrating agent is provided. In addition, a method of stable preservation of produced capsinoid by purifying the obtained capsinoid under stable conditions is provided. A fatty acid represented by the formula (1) and a hydroxymethylphenol represented by the formula (2) are condensed without solvent or in a low-polar solvent, using an enzyme as a catalyst to give an ester compound represented by the formula (3). In addition, a fatty acid represented by the formula (4) is added to the ester compound represented by the formula (3) for stabilization. wherein each symbol is as defined in the specification.

- SYNTHESIS OF THE RACEMIC PROPIONATE OF 8-METHYL-2-DECANOL, THE SEX HORMONE OF THE SEVERAL LEAF-EATING BUGS Diabrotica (CHRYSOMELIDAE)
-
A new method has been developed for the synthesis of sex hormone of Diabrotica leaf-eating bugs, namely, the racemic propionate of 8-methyl-2-decanol, from 7-methyl-1-nonanol, which, in turn, was obtained by two methods using the Grignard reaction from furfural and from 2,3-dibromotetrahydropyran.
